Evaluate the anti-tumor efficacy and safety of platinum-based doublet chemotherapy combined with tislelizumab and voriconazole as neoadjuvant therapy in patients with resectable stage II-III non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C) with pulmonary Aspergillus colonization: a prospective, exploratory, single-arm phase II clinical study

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. The subject voluntarily participates in this study and signs the informed consent form; 2. Male or female patients aged between 18 and 75 years old; 3. Histologically confirmed non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C), with resectable stage II–III disease (AJCC 9th edition); 4. No prior systemic antitumor treatment for this lung cancer (including chemotherapy, immunotherapy, or targeted therapy); 5. Meets the indications for NSCLC immunotherapy, without known EGFR, ALK, ROS1, or other driver gene mutations; 6. Detection of Aspergillus in the subject's bronchoalveolar lavage fluid (BALF) by fluorescence PCR method; 7. At least one measurable lesion according to RECIST 1.1 criteria; 8. ECOG performance status score of 0–1; 9.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1. Mixed-type lung cancer with small cell carcinoma, neuroendocrine carcinoma, or sarcomatoid components is not eligible for enrollment; 2. Received any of the following treatments: (1) Prior treatment with any immune checkpoint inhibitor (anti-PD-1/PD-L1, etc.); (2) Major surgery within 4 weeks prior to the first dose of study drug (e.g., craniotomy; thoracotomy or laparotomy, etc.), with major surgery defined as Grade 3 and Grade 4 surgeries specified in the "Administrative Measures for Clinical Application of Medical Technologies" implemented on November 1, 2018; (3) Radiation therapy to more than 30% of the bone marrow, or extensive-field radiotherapy within 4 weeks prior to the first dose of study drug; (4) Use of, or requirement for, strong CYP3A4 inhibitors, strong inducers, or drugs with narrow therapeutic windows that are sensitive CYP3A4 substrates within 7 days prior to the first dose of study drug (as azole antifungals are CYP3A4 inhibitors/substrates, posing interaction risk). 3. Active, known, or suspected autoimmune disease (well-controlled Type 1 diabetes mellitus, hypothyroidism requiring only hormone replacement therapy, and skin conditions not requiring systemic treatment such as vitiligo or psoriasis are permitted); 4.
